Chelsea manager Jose Mourinho has insisted that he has a more balanced squad to work with this season than last term.

The Blues, who finished third in the Premier League in 2013/14, have made a sensational start to the campaign by winning all their first four league fixtures, with new signing Diego Costa scoring seven goals.




Mourinho feels he has a better squad than last season in terms of balance and depth and has more options to work with.

"I don't want to compare squads, but ours is better than it was last season [because] we have more solutions. We have a good balance”, the Portuguese said in a press conference today.
 


Mourinho’s claims on the strength of his squad will be severely tested when the Blues travel to the Etihad Stadium to take on Manchester City this Sunday.

However, the Portuguese said that Chelsea are good enough to match the champions and go toe to toe this weekend and insists he is looking forward to a perfect performance from his side.

“It's always a good time to play against big teams because it makes my job easy. We respect City totally because they deserve it, but we believe in ourselves.

“The perfect situation is to score a lot of goals and not concede, and we have to chase that perfection."

After two wins, a draw and a loss, Manchester City are fifth in the Premier League table on seven points.
